An out-of-bounds memory access vulnerability has been identified in specific firmware versions of Milesight AIOT cameras. This vulnerability is tracked as CVE-2026-20766 and affects industrial IoT camera systems. The issue involves improper memory handling that could potentially allow attackers to access memory outside the intended boundaries. CISA has issued an advisory (ICSA-26-113-03) regarding this vulnerability. Milesight has made firmware updates available to address this security flaw. The vulnerability impacts the security of IoT camera infrastructure and could pose risks to surveillance systems.
